Table Components

  • Number - Table # or Figure #
  • Title – brief, descriptive and italicized
  • Headings – column headings, capitalize first letter, center the heading
  • Body – all the headings and cells of the table, left-align the first column, all other columns are centered
  • Note(s) in this order (general, specific, probability) – definitions of abbreviations, copyright attribution, explanations of asterisks used to indicate p values

Figure components

  • Number - Table # or Figure #
  • Title – brief, descriptive and italicized
  • Image – chart, graph, photograph, drawing, plot, infographic, or other illustration
  • Legend – positioned within the borders of the figure and explains any symbols used in the figure
  • Note in this order (general, specific, probability) – (definitions of abbreviations, copyright attribution, explanations of asterisks used to indicate p values)
